"Dabangg" is a high-octane Bollywood blockbuster that follows the fearless and charismatic police officer, Chulbul Pandey (Salman Khan), as he takes on the corrupt forces that threaten his small town. Known for his unorthodox methods and larger-than-life personality, Chulbul soon finds himself facing off against a ruthless villain, Chedi Singh (Sonu Sood), who will stop at nothing to exert his control. As the tension escalates, Chulbul must navigate a web of deceit, betrayal, and danger to protect his loved ones and uphold the values of justice. Alongside the explosive action sequences and exhilarating dance numbers, "Dabangg" delves into themes of family, loyalty, and standing up against injustice. Sonakshi Sinha shines as Rajjo, Chulbul's feisty love interest who adds a layer of heart and emotion to the film. Arbaaz Khan delivers a memorable performance as Makkhi, Chulbul's loyal brother who finds himself caught in the crossfire of their volatile world.
